Core Viewpoint - The article highlights the launch of a fully self-developed orthopedic surgical robotic arm by Yuanhua Intelligent, marking a significant advancement in China's medical robotics industry, transitioning from integrated innovation to original innovation tailored for specific clinical needs [5][20]. Group 1: Product Development and Features - The newly unveiled robotic arm is designed specifically for orthopedic surgeries, enhancing the precision and stability required for procedures such as joint replacement and spinal surgeries [6][12]. - Yuanhua Intelligent's robotic arm boasts a 100% domestic procurement rate for its core components, which reduces costs and mitigates supply chain risks [8]. - The robotic arm incorporates advanced technologies such as high-frequency navigation and closed-loop control systems, achieving sub-millimeter positioning accuracy and significantly improving surgical precision and safety [10][12]. Group 2: Clinical Impact and Adoption - The robotic arm is expected to reduce the learning curve for young orthopedic surgeons, requiring only about 10 surgeries to master the robotic-assisted techniques, thus lowering error rates and enhancing the training of medical professionals [18]. - The introduction of this robotic arm aligns with the increasing demand for orthopedic surgeries in China, where the number of joint replacement surgeries exceeded 1 million in 2022, growing at an annual rate of nearly 20% [17][18]. - The device's design aims to standardize surgical outcomes across different surgeons and institutions, potentially balancing medical resources across regions [20]. Group 3: Industry Transformation - The development of this specialized robotic arm signifies a shift in the orthopedic surgical robotics landscape, moving from generic solutions to tailored, specialized applications that meet specific clinical requirements [5][20]. - Yuanhua Intelligent's approach reflects a broader trend in the industry towards self-research and development, which is expected to break down technological barriers and promote the widespread adoption of high-precision medical equipment [20].
